You can help a local organization that helps at-risk children this weekend.
CASA of Rock County is hosting its fourth annual Fall Festival fundraiser at The Barn on Prairie on County G between Janesville and Beloit on Saturday, Oct. 5.
CASA, which stands for court-appointed special advocates, recruits, trains and supervises volunteers who work with children in the foster care system who have suffered abuse and neglect.
Volunteers act as companions for the kids they work with and they also produce court reports so judges know what is going on in the kids’ lives and what services they might need.
The upcoming festival will run from noon to 10 p.m. and will feature food trucks, live music and raffles. Kids activities such as face painting, crafts and carnival games will be available until 6 p.m.
